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90667573 060842 3265901 75 51083
271699260 5569 2158100
271699260 5569 2158100
44861 907368 39182959506 34 2275476
All about undefined
Interested in learning more?
271699260 5569 2158100
44861 907368 39182959506 34 2275476
See more
6068244050 69
454932 05580 983
See more
54947 98907 4781744260
421 96 4097535 082
See more